Your new role:
As a Clinical Nurse within the Early Psychosis Team, you will provide advanced specialist mental health nursing care to consumers experiencing complex mental health needs, while delivering clinical leadership and contributing to positive recovery-focused outcomes for consumers and their families/carers.
- Provide advanced clinical assessment, care planning, risk assessment and evidence-based mental health interventions for consumers within a multidisciplinary team environment.
- Lead and coordinate the delivery of high-quality, person-centred care, applying expert clinical judgement, critical thinking and problem-solving skills to complex presentations.
- Support and mentor nursing staff, students and colleagues through clinical leadership, education, supervision and the promotion of best-practice standards.
- Contribute to service improvement through quality activities, research, clinical audits, change management initiatives and adherence to safety and professional practice standards.
About you:
We are seeking a motivated and experienced mental health nurse who is passionate about delivering recovery-focused care and fostering positive outcomes for consumers, families and carers.
- Registered Nurse with current registration through the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ia, supported by substantial experience in mental health nursing and advanced clinical practice.
- Demonstrated expertise in mental health assessment, risk management, care planning and the delivery of evidence-based interventions for consumers with complex mental health needs.
- Strong leadership, communication and relationship-building skills, with the ability to work collaboratively across multidisciplinary teams and support the development of others.
- Commitment to continuous improvement, professional development, quality improvement activities and the application of contemporary mental health nursing knowledge, research and best-practice principles.
